Why Routine Chimney Inspections Matter in Ohio

Even with minimal fireplace usage, Ohio's freeze-thaw cycles, heavy snowfall, and humid summers can quickly degrade critical chimney elements. Periodic chimney inspections are essential to verify structural stability, proper clearances, and venting requirements per NFPA 211 and local code. A certified technician will examine creosote levels, inspect for moisture intrusion, inspect crown and flashing, and confirm that termination devices operate correctly. They'll also evaluate ventilation pathways and assess carbon monoxide hazards.

Regular inspections help maintain periodic maintenance by spotting initial problems such as tiny mortar breaks, brick damage, and metalwork degradation before they worsen. This reduces fire dangers, boost chimney efficiency, and prolong equipment lifespan. Be sure to implement wildlife prevention by confirming well-maintained caps and screens designed to keep out wildlife and pests from building homes while maintaining proper airflow.

Signs Your Fireplace or Chimney Needs Immediate Attention

Scheduled checks detect problems in their early stages, but you should monitor for signals that demand immediate service to meet requirements of NFPA 211 and Ohio building codes. If you notice lingering smoke smell, inadequate airflow, or creosote marks, you might have a chimney obstruction or heavy creosote deposits that elevates fire risk. Place carbon monoxide monitors and treat any CO alert as urgent. Check for moisture marks on ceilings or near the firebox, which point to a damaged flashing. Be aware of wildlife and obstructions. Check for chimney lean, damaged brickwork, or masonry deterioration requiring immediate assessment. Problematic or smoldering fires suggest airflow problems. Any exhaust backup, spark ejection, or loose fragments requires a CSIA-certified inspection right away.

Essential Guidelines for Yearly Cleaning and Creosote Removal

For best results, book a CSIA-certified inspection and cleaning once per heating season - or more frequently if you use your fireplace often or observe Stage 2-3 creosote. This adheres to NFPA 211 recommendations and minimizes creosote buildup. Consider booking during off-peak times to avoid delays. A certified professional will inspect chimney integrity, draft performance, safety distances, and connection integrity, followed by removing soot and creosote deposits using professional-grade cleaning equipment and HEPA filtration systems.

You can assist between uses by following these guidelines: burn only seasoned hardwood (under 20% moisture), keep proper air flow to prevent smoldering, and keep flue temperatures steady. Mount a thermometer on stoves and ensure smoke path components are secure. After burning through each cord, inspect for 1/8 inch deposits; when reaching 1/4 inch, discontinue use until cleaning is completed.

Expert Services: Masonry Work, Crown & Cap Repairs, Waterproofing Solutions

Once creosote is managed, you must preserve the chimney's structural integrity and weather protection. Ohio's freeze-thaw cycles can damage brick and mortar joints, so schedule mortar repair using ASTM-certified masonry materials and compatible joint tooling for present joint work. Restore damaged crowns using a strengthened, fiber-reinforced cement mixture, properly angled and featuring an protruding drainage edge for water protection. Mount or renew stainless-steel caps with corrosion-resistant attachments and properly sized spark arrestors sized to the chimney outlet.

Make flashing repair at roof intersections a top priority, properly installing step and counter-flashing within mortar joints. Ensure proper lap sealing and maintain safe distances from combustibles as specified in NFPA 211 guidelines. Use vapor-permeable waterproofing treatments on exterior masonry and avoid using film-forming sealers that prevent moisture escape. Document thoroughly all repairs, curing periods, and warranties, and implement routine seasonal inspections to verify proper performance.

Available Liner Materials

Selecting the right chimney liner material begins with matching it to your equipment, fuel specifications, and local requirements. Stainless steel options provide durability and are UL-listed for all fuel types including gas, oil, and wood. Consider choosing rigid stainless for direct flue paths or flexible stainless for curves; select 316 material for wood and oil systems and 304 for gas when permitted. Add insulation as needed for maintaining appropriate clearances and optimal flue temperatures.

Ceramic options consist of both clay tile and cast-in-place solutions. Clay offers an affordable solution for new masonry construction but needs proper dimensioning and well-maintained joints. Cast-in-place liners strengthen older stacks and provide an uninterrupted, heat-resistant flue.

Evaluate corrosion classification, temperature shock endurance, and diameter sizing as per NFPA 211 and manufacturer requirements. Make sure to confirm fitting compatibility, terminal fittings, and Ohio building code compliance before proceeding with installation.

Security and Performance

Although choosing a liner starts with dimensional requirements and materials, operational safety and efficiency depend on how well the liner controls heat, draft, and combustion byproducts as specified by regulations. You need a continuous, properly sized flue path to ensure stable airflow, enhance chimney performance, and stop flue gases from cooling that leads to condensed creosote or acids. Effective insulation keeps exhaust temperature, enhancing burn performance and reducing fire hazards. Chemical-resistant liners manage carbon monoxide and water vapor, protecting the masonry and nearby combustible materials.

Match the liner diameter based on the appliance outlet as specified by NFPA 211 and manufacturer listings; excessive diameter diminishes draft, using too small a diameter elevates stack temperature and gas escape. Confirm proper clearances and sealed joints. Mount carbon monoxide detectors for each story and adjacent to sleeping areas. Book annual Level II inspections and log performance measurements: temperature, carbon monoxide levels, and draft parameters.

Key Benefits of Top-Sealing Dampers

Often underestimated, a top-sealing damper offers vital protection by closing off the flue at the top. This important component stops heating and cooling losses, stops downward air movement, and prevents water damage and pest entry. By creating a seal at the top, it helps decrease the column of cold air in the flue, enhancing energy efficiency and reducing stack-effect heat loss during the long winter months in Ohio. Furthermore, you'll preserve your flue from rain and snow damage, reducing ice damage and corrosion.

Equipped with stainless hardware and a high-temperature gasket, working via a firebox-mounted cable. It's required to open it completely before kindling any fire to ensure proper combustion and safe venting in accordance with NFPA 211. Our specialists measure and anchor the frame to correspond to your flue tile, confirm lid travel and seal compression, and ensure smoke-tight closure for regulation-compliant performance.

How Much Do Chimney and Fireplace Services Cost in Ohio?

The typical cost ranges from $100-$250 for a Level 1 sweep, $200-$400 for safety inspections, and $300-$1,200 for minor masonry or crown repairs. A full relining project runs $1,500-$4,000; tuckpointing averages $8-$20 per linear foot. Construction and rebuild costs fluctuate based on codes and materials. Emergency service calls include $100-$300 added after-hours. Ask for detailed written specifications referencing NFPA 211 guidelines and liability coverage documentation. Confirm Level 2/3 inspection requirements prior to real estate transactions or following fire incidents.

How Long Does a Standard Chimney Service Appointment Take?

Schedule a 60 to 90 minute appointment. This timeframe covers initial setup, site access, and standard NFPA 211 inspection protocols. You will get a comprehensive visual Level I assessment, including draft and clearance checks, and a detailed technician checklist documenting the condition of your flue, cap, crown, firebox, and smoke chamber. Should sweeping be needed, add 30-60 minutes with HEPA-controlled equipment. Camera inspections (Level II) or masonry work will extend the duration. Please ensure all pets are safely confined and the firebox has been inactive for 12 hours beforehand.
